Output 762639bb61e430b3832bba067498f2837375beacd312b32e13ee110f29ea9bc8:1

value
1986700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eba7010d845aac00be3c57a6791e61db5156cfe OP_EQUAL
address
38sHyRqMJzPQqQSRvnRRFuLngEfzB755ks
transaction
762639bb61e430b3832bba067498f2837375beacd312b32e13ee110f29ea9bc8
spent
true